THIS AGREEMENT, dated as of [ ], is made by and between
Eaglemark, Inc., a Nevada corporation, as seller hereunder (together with its
successors and assigns "EAGLEMARK" or "SELLER"), and Eaglemark Customer Funding
Corporation-IV, a Nevada corporation and wholly-owned subsidiary of Seller
(together with its successors and assigns "TRUST DEPOSITOR"), as purchaser
hereunder.
WHEREAS, in the regular course of its business, Seller purchases and
services motorcycle conditional sales contracts from Harley-Davidson motorcycle
retailers, each of which contracts provides for installment payment obligations
by or on behalf of the retailer's customer/purchaser and grants a security
interest in a Harley-Davidson motorcycle in order to secure such obligations;
WHEREAS, Seller and Trust Depositor wish to set forth the terms and
conditions pursuant to which Trust Depositor will acquire from time to time the
"CONTRACT ASSETS," as hereinafter defined; and
WHEREAS, Trust Depositor intends concurrently with its purchases from
time to time of Contract Assets hereunder to convey all right, title and
interest in such Contract Assets to Harley-Davidson Eaglemark Motorcycle Trust
[ ] (the "TRUST") pursuant to the Sale and Servicing Agreement dated as
of [ ] by and among Trust Depositor, Eaglemark, as Servicer, and
Harley-Davidson Eaglemark Motorcycle Trust [ ], as issuer (the "ISSUER")
(as amended, supplemented or otherwise modified from time to time, the "SALE AND
SERVICING AGREEMENT"), executed concurrently herewith;
NOW, THEREFORE, in consideration of the premises and the mutual
agreements hereinafter set forth, Seller and Trust Depositor agree as follows:

SECTION 2.01. CLOSING. Subject to and upon the terms and conditions set
forth in this Agreement, Seller hereby sells, transfers, assigns, sets over and
otherwise conveys to Trust Depositor, in consideration of Trust Depositor's
payment of $[ ] in cash as the Purchase Price therefor,
(i) all the right, title and interest of Seller in and to the Initial Contracts
listed on the initial List of Contracts in effect on the Closing Date
(including, without limitation, all security interests and all rights to receive
payments which are collected pursuant thereto on or after the Cutoff Date,
including any liquidation proceeds therefrom, but excluding any rights to
receive payments which were collected pursuant thereto prior to the Cutoff
Date), (ii) all rights of Seller under any physical damage or other individual
insurance policy (including a "FORCED PLACED" policy, if any) relating to any
such Contract, an Obligor or a Motorcycle securing such Contract, (iii) all
security interests in each such Motorcycle, (iv) all documents contained in the
related Contract Files, (v) all rights of Seller in the Lockbox, Lockbox Account
and related Lockbox Agreement to the extent they relate to the Contracts, (vi)
all rights (but not the obligations) of the Seller under any motorcycle dealer
agreements between the dealers (i.e. the originators of the Contracts) and the
Seller, and (vii) all proceeds and products of the foregoing (items (i) - (vii),
together with the additional assets referred to in Section 2.04 below which may
be transferred from time to time in respect of Subsequent Contracts, being
collectively referred to herein as the "CONTRACT ASSETS"). Although Seller and
Trust Depositor agree that any such transfer is intended to be a sale of
ownership in the Contract Assets, rather than the mere granting of a security
interest to secure a borrowing, in the event such transfer is deemed to be of a
mere security interest to secure indebtedness, Seller shall be deemed to have
granted Trust Depositor a perfected first priority security interest in such
Contract Assets and this Agreement shall constitute a security agreement under
applicable law. If such transfer is deemed to be the mere granting of a
security interest to secure a borrowing, Trust Depositor may, to
1
secure Trust Depositor's own borrowing under the Sale and Servicing Agreement
(to the extent that the transfer of the Contract Assets thereunder is deemed
to be a mere granting of a security interest to secure a borrowing) repledge
and reassign (i) all or a portion of the Contract Assets pledged to Trust
Depositor and not released from the security interest of this Agreement at
the time of such pledge and assignment, and (ii) all proceeds thereof. Such
repledge and reassignment may be made by Trust Depositor with or without a
repledge and reassignment by Trust Depositor of its rights under this
Agreement, and without further notice to or acknowledgment from Seller.
Seller waives, to the extent permitted by applicable law, all claims, causes
of action and remedies, whether legal or equitable (including any right of
setoff), against Trust Depositor or any assignee of Trust Depositor relating
to such action by Trust Depositor in connection with the transactions
contemplated by the Sale and Servicing Agreement.

ARTICLE III
REPRESENTATIONS AND WARRANTIES
Seller makes the following representations and warranties, on which Trust
Depositor will rely in purchasing the initial Contract Assets on the Closing
Date (and any Subsequent Contracts on the related Subsequent Transfer Date) and
concurrently reconveying the same to the Trust, and on which the Trust, the
Noteholders and Certificateholders will rely under the Sale and Servicing
Agreement. Such representations speak as of the execution and delivery of this
Agreement and as of the Closing Date in the case of the Initial Contracts, and
as of the applicable Subsequent Transfer Date in the case of Subsequent
Contracts, but shall survive the sale, transfer and assignment of the Contracts
to the Trust. The repurchase obligation of Seller set forth in Section 5.01
below and in Section 7.08 of the Sale and Servicing Agreement constitutes the
sole remedy available for a breach of a representation or warranty of Seller set
forth in Section 3.02, 3.03 or 3.04 of this Agreement.

SECTION 3.02. REPRESENTATIONS AND WARRANTIES REGARDING EACH CONTRACT.
Seller represents and warrants as to each Contract as of the execution and
delivery of this Agreement and as of the Closing Date, in the case of the
Initial Contracts, and as of the applicable Subsequent Transfer Date, in the
case of Subsequent Contracts, that:
(a) LIST OF CONTRACTS. The information set forth in the List
of Contracts (or Subsequent List of Contracts, in the case of Subsequent
Contracts) is true, complete and correct as of the Initial Cutoff Date or
applicable Subsequent Cutoff Date, as the case may be.
(b) PAYMENTS. As of the Initial Cutoff Date or applicable
Subsequent Cutoff Date, as the case may be, the most recent scheduled
payment with respect to any Contract either had been made or was not
delinquent for more than 30 days. To the best of Seller's knowledge, all
payments made on each Contract were made by the respective Obligor.
(c) NO WAIVERS. As of the Closing Date (or the applicable
Subsequent Transfer Date, in the case of Subsequent Contracts), the terms
of the Contracts have not been waived, altered or modified in any
respect, except by instruments or documents included in the related
Contract File.
(d) BINDING OBLIGATION. Each Contract is the genuine, legal,
valid and binding obligation of the Obligor thereunder and is enforceable
in accordance with its terms, except as such enforceability may be
limited by laws affecting the enforcement of creditors' rights generally.
5
(e) NO DEFENSES. No Contract is subject to any right of
rescission, setoff, counterclaim or defense, including the defense of
usury, and the operation of any of the terms of such Contract or the
exercise of any right thereunder will not render the Contract
unenforceable in whole or in part or subject to any right of rescission,
setoff, counterclaim or defense, including the defense of usury, and no
such right of rescission, setoff, counterclaim or defense has been
asserted with respect thereto.
(f) INSURANCE. As of the Closing Date (or the applicable
Subsequent Transfer Date in the case of Subsequent Contracts), the
related Motorcycle securing each Contract is covered by physical damage
insurance (i) in an amount not less than the value of the Motorcycle at
the time of origination of the Contract, (ii) naming Seller as a loss
payee and (iii) insuring against loss and damage due to fire, theft,
transportation, collision and other risks covered by comprehensive
coverage, and all premiums due on such insurance have been paid in full
from the date of the Contract's origination.
(g) ORIGINATION. Each Contract was originated by a
Harley-Davidson motorcycle dealer in the regular course of its business
which dealer had all necessary licenses and permits to originate the
Contracts in the state where such dealer was located, was fully and
properly executed by the parties thereto, and has been purchased by
Seller in the regular course of its business. Each Contract was sold by
such motorcycle dealer to the Seller without any fraud or
misrepresentation on the part of such motorcycle dealer.
(h) LAWFUL ASSIGNMENT. No Contract was originated in or is
subject to the laws of any jurisdiction whose laws would make the sale,
transfer and assignment of the Contract under this Agreement or under the
Sale and Servicing Agreement or under the Indenture or pursuant to
transfers of the Certificates unlawful, void or voidable.
(i) COMPLIANCE WITH LAW. None of the Contracts, the
origination of the Contracts by the dealers, the purchase of the
Contracts by the Seller, the sale of the Contracts by the Seller to the
Trust Depositor or by the Trust Depositor to the Trust, or any
combination of the foregoing, violated as of the Closing Date or as of
any Subsequent Transfer Date, as applicable, any requirement of any
federal, state or local law and regulations thereunder, including,
without limitation, usury, truth in lending, motor vehicle installment
loan and equal credit opportunity laws, applicable to the Contracts and
the sale of Motorcycles. Seller shall, for at least the period of this
Agreement, maintain in its possession, available for the Trust
Depositor's and the Trustees' inspection, and shall deliver to Trust
Depositor or the Trustee upon demand, evidence of compliance with all
such requirements.
(j) CONTRACT IN FORCE. As of the Closing Date (or the
applicable Subsequent Transfer Date in the case of Subsequent Contracts),
no Contract has been satisfied or subordinated in whole or in part or
rescinded, and the related Motorcycle securing any Contract has not been
released from the lien of the Contract in whole or in part.
(k) VALID SECURITY INTEREST. Each Contract creates a valid,
subsisting and enforceable first priority perfected security interest in
favor of Seller in the Motorcycle covered thereby, and such security
interest has been assigned by Seller to the Trust Depositor. The
original certificate of title, certificate of lien or other notification
(the "LIEN CERTIFICATE") issued by the body responsible for the
registration of, and the issuance of certificates of title relating to,
motor vehicles and liens thereon (the "REGISTRAR OF TITLES") of the
applicable state to a secured party which indicates the lien of the
secured party on the Motorcycle is recorded on the original certificate
of title, and the original certificate of title for each Motorcycle,
show, or if a new or replacement Lien Certificate is being applied for
with respect to such Motorcycle the Lien Certificate will be received
within 180 days of the Closing Date (or the applicable Subsequent
Transfer Date in the case of Subsequent Contracts) and will show, the
Seller as original secured party under each Contract as the holder of a
first priority security interest in such Motorcycle. With respect to
each Contract for which the Lien Certificate has not yet been returned
from the Registrar of Titles, the Seller has received written evidence
from the related dealer that such Lien Certificate showing the Seller as
lienholder has been applied for. The Seller's security interest has been
validly assigned by the Seller to the Trust Depositor and by the Trust
Depositor to the Issuer and Owner Trustee
6
pursuant to this Agreement. Immediately after the sale, each Contract
will be secured by an enforceable and perfected first priority
security interest in the Motorcycle in favor of the Trust as secured
party, which security interest is prior to all other liens upon and
security interests in such Motorcycle which now exist or may hereafter
arise or be created (except, as to priority, for any lien for taxes,
labor, materials or of any state law enforcement agency affecting a
Motorcycle).

ARTICLE V
REMEDIES UPON MISREPRESENTATION
SECTION 5.01. REPURCHASES OF CONTRACTS FOR BREACH OF REPRESENTATIONS AND
WARRANTIES. Seller hereby agrees, for the benefit of the Trustees and the Trust
Depositor, that it shall repurchase a Contract including any Subsequent
Contracts (together with all related Contract Assets), at its Repurchase Price,
not later than two Business Days prior to the first Determination Date after
Seller becomes aware, or should have become aware, or receives written notice
from Trust Depositor, either of the Trustees or the Servicer of any breach of a
representation or warranty of Seller set forth in Article III of this Agreement
that materially adversely affects Trust Depositor's or the Trust's interest in
such Contract (without regard to the benefits of the Reserve Fund) and which
breach has not been cured; PROVIDED, HOWEVER, that with respect to any Contract
incorrectly described on the List of Contracts with respect to unpaid Principal
Balance which Seller would otherwise be required to repurchase pursuant to this
Section 5.01 and Section 7.08 of the Sale and Servicing Agreement, Seller may,
in lieu of repurchasing such Contract, deposit in the Collection Account not
later than two Business Days prior to such Determination Date cash in an amount
sufficient to cure such deficiency or discrepancy; and PROVIDED FURTHER that
with respect to a breach of a representation or warranty relating to the
Contracts in the aggregate and not to any particular Contract, Seller may select
Contracts (without adverse selection) to repurchase such that had such Contracts
not been reconveyed by Trust Depositor and included as part of the Trust there
would have been no breach of such representation or warranty; PROVIDED FURTHER
that (a) the failure of a Contract File to be complete or of the original
certificate of title and evidence of recordation of such certificate to be
included in the Contract File as of 180 days after the Closing Date (or
Subsequent Transfer Date, in the case of Subsequent Contracts), or (b) the
failure to maintain perfection of the security interest in the Motorcycle
securing a Contract in accordance with the Sale and Servicing Agreement, shall
be deemed to be a breach materially and adversely affecting the Trust's interest
in the Contracts or in the related Contract Assets. Notwithstanding any other
provision of this Agreement, the obligation of Seller under this Section 5.01
and under Section 7.08 of the Sale and Servicing Agreement shall not terminate
upon a Service Transfer pursuant to Article VIII of the Sale and Servicing
Agreement.
SECTION 5.02. SELLER'S REPURCHASE OPTION. On written notice to the Owner
Trustee and the Indenture Trustee at least 20 days prior to a Distribution Date,
provided the Pool Balance is then less than 10% of the Initial Pool Balance,
Seller may (but is not required to) repurchase from the Trust on that
Distribution Date all outstanding Contracts (and related Contract Assets) at a
price equal to the Class A-2 Notes and the principal balance of the Certificates
on the previous Distribution Date plus the aggregate of the Note Interest
Distributable Amount and the Certificate Interest Distributable Amount for the
current Distribution Date as well as the accrued and unpaid Monthly Servicing
Fee and
10
Trustees' Fees to the date of such repurchase, provided the Seller is in
receipt of a valuation letter by the Seller's financial advisor that the
Seller's repurchase is for fair and adequate consideration. Such price will
be deposited in the Collection Account not later than one Business Day before
such Distribution Date, against the Trustees' release of the Contracts and
Contract Files as described in Section 7.10 of the Sale and Servicing
Agreement.
ARTICLE VI
INDEMNITIES
SECTION 6.01. SELLER INDEMNIFICATION. Seller will defend and indemnify
Trust Depositor, the Trust, the Trustees, any agents of the Trustees and the
Certificateholders and Noteholders against any and all costs, expenses, losses,
damages, claims and liabilities, joint or several, including reasonable fees and
expenses of counsel and expenses of litigation arising out of or resulting from
(i) this Agreement or the use, ownership or operation of any Motorcycle by
Seller or the Servicer or any Affiliate of either, (ii) any representation or
warranty or covenant made by Seller in this Agreement being untrue or incorrect
(subject to the second sentence of the preamble to Article III of this Agreement
above), and (iii) any untrue statement or alleged untrue statement of a material
fact contained in the Offering Memorandum or in any amendment thereto or the
omission or alleged omission to state therein a material fact necessary to make
the statements therein, in light of the circumstances in which they were made,
not misleading, in each case to the extent, but only to the extent, that such
untrue statement or alleged untrue statement was made in conformity with
information furnished to Trust Depositor by Seller specifically for use therein.
Notwithstanding any other provision of this Agreement, the obligation of Seller
under this Section 6.01 shall not terminate upon a Service Transfer pursuant to
Article VIII of the Sale and Servicing Agreement and shall survive any
termination of that agreement or this Agreement.
SECTION 6.02. LIABILITIES TO OBLIGORS. No obligation or liability to any
Obligor under any of the Contracts is intended to be assumed by the Trustees,
the Trust, the Noteholders or the Certificateholders under or as a result of
this Agreement and the transactions contemplated hereby.
SECTION 6.03. TAX INDEMNIFICATION. Seller agrees to pay, and to
indemnify, defend and hold harmless the Trust Depositor, the Trust, the
Trustees, the Noteholders or the Certificateholders from, any taxes which may at
any time be asserted with respect to, and as of the date of, the transfer of the
Contracts to Trust Depositor hereunder and the concurrent reconveyance to the
Trust and the further pledge by the Trust to the Indenture Trustee, including,
without limitation, any sales, gross receipts, general corporation, personal
property, privilege or license taxes (but not including any federal, state or
other taxes arising out of the creation of the Trust and the issuance of the
Notes and Certificates) and costs, expenses and reasonable counsel fees in
defending against the same, whether arising by reason of the acts to be
performed by Seller or the Servicer under this Agreement or the Sale and
Servicing Agreement or imposed against the Trust, a Noteholder, a
Certificateholder or otherwise. Notwithstanding any other provision of this
Agreement, the obligation of Seller under this Section 6.03 shall not terminate
upon a Service Transfer pursuant to Article VIII of the Sale and Servicing
Agreement and shall survive any termination of this Agreement.
SECTION 6.04. OPERATION OF INDEMNITIES. Indemnification under this
Article VI shall include, without limitation, reasonable fees and expenses of
counsel and expenses of litigation. If Seller has made any indemnity payments
to Trust Depositor or the Trustees pursuant to this Article VI and Trust
Depositor or the Trustees thereafter collects any of such amounts from others,
Trust Depositor or the Trustees will repay such amounts collected to Seller,
except that any payments received by Trust Depositor or the Trustees from an
insurance provider as a result of the events under which the Seller's indemnity
payments arose shall be repaid prior to any repayment of the Seller's indemnity
payment.
